                                   JUDGMENT

The petitioner, who is working as a Watcher at Kunnamthanam Devaswom in Thiruvalla group, is aggrieved by Ext.P1 order of the 3rd respondent by which he was relieved from Varkala Devaswom on the basis of the order passed by the 2nd respondent on 10.12.2019, transferring him from Varkala to Thiruvalla.

2. Aggrieved by the same, petitioner has approached the Devaswom Board with Ext.P2 petition. The petitioner has also claimed a posting at Sabarimala for makaravilakku duty by submitting Ext.P4 representation.

However, no direction can be given at this stage as the duties are to be performed by next week and all arrangements are already made for the same. Regarding Ext.P2 representation, there shall be a direction to the 1st respondent to consider the same and pass orders within a period of two WP(C).No.71 OF 2020 3 months, from the date of receipt of a copy of this judgment.

Accordingly, this writ petition is disposed of.
